[ ] Leaked-FD sweep — before cutting the Hollowbarn 5.2 release, run the descriptor-leak hunt on the staging soak cluster. The watcher must report zero net FD growth over a six-hour window under replayed production load. Last cycle we shipped with a slow socket leak in the sync daemon; that class of regression now blocks release. Attach the watcher summary to the release record and confirm the soak ran against the exact candidate identified by the token below.

session token of tajef-bageg = htk21_5d90d574934f3ccae6437

Handover — Backup Tape Rotation

Shift lead: six tapes from the Garnet set are boxed and sealed, staged on rack 2. Do not open the case. Swap set (Opal) comes back on the same run — count them in, log both ways. Courier is Mirefield Secure, due 14:00. ID check before anything moves. No substitutions, no partial loads. Give the courier the following instruction at hand-over.

dispatch memo: the lamwyn fenwyn courier leaves the wenir ledger at gate 7175 under passcode 822969

Quarterly Planning Note — Supplier Renewal

Sales leads: the Marivelle Components contract expires at quarter-end, and Orrinbrook Ltd intends to renew on revised terms. Negotiations target a 3% unit-cost reduction in exchange for a two-year commitment and higher minimum volumes. Please factor potential lead-time changes into customer commitments until terms are signed. The renewal's connection to our broader commercial plans is outlined in the note below.

board note of kageg-bahof: The renewal with Holwynax Holdings closes at $2 million a year, 5 percent below the last contract. Project Ulaath slips by two quarters because of the supplier delay.

MEMO — Kettling Depot Receiving

Uniform sets for the new Kettling depot arrive Wednesday via Ashgrove courier: 40 boxes, sorted by size, manifest attached to box one. Check the count at the dock before signing; shortages go straight to stores, not the courier. The hand-over instruction the courier will follow is set out below.

drop instructions, tafof-baguf: the holmir gilox courier leaves the sormir ulaok holdor ledger at gate 5596 under passcode 257343